body, div, ul, h1, h2, h3, p, table, tr, td, form, ul, li {margin: 0px; padding: 0px; border: 0px; font-family: courier new, Arial, Tahoma, Geneva, sans-serif; font-size: 12px; color: #210;}
body {background: url(../images/body_bg_001.jpg) #000 center top; text-align: center; height: 100%; overflow: -moz-scrollbars-vertical;}

img, a {margin: 0px; padding: 0px; border: 0px; font-weight: 900;}
img, div {float: left;}
img {margin-bottom: 16px;}
a {color: #821;}
a:hover {color: #210;}
strong {color: #006eae;}
p {line-height: 20px; margin-bottom: 16px;}

h2 {font-size: 18px; font-family: Trebuchet MS; font-weight: 300; font-style: italic; color: #821; width: 500px; margin-bottom: 16px; display: block; float: left; height: 30px;}
/*h2 {background: url(../images/title_bg_001.jpg) right; font-size: 18px; font-family: Trebuchet MS; font-weight: 300; color: #fff; display: block; float: left; padding: 0px 40px 0px 16px; height: 35px; margin-bottom: 16px;}
h2 img {margin-right: 10px; float: none;}
h2 span {position: relative; top: 5px;}*/
h3 {font-size: 14px; color: #c00; margin-bottom: 16px;}

#center_position {width: 1000px; margin: auto; float: none; display: block; overflow: hidden;}
#container_shadows {background: url(../images/container_shadows_001.jpg) no-repeat; width: 1000px; margin-bottom: 32px; overflow: hidden;}
#container_shadows .top {background: url(../images/container_shadows_top_bg_001.jpg); width: 1000px; height: 32px; display: block;}
#container_shadows .bottom {background: url(../images/container_shadows_bottom_001.gif); width: 1000px; height: 1px; display: block; overflow: hidden;}
#container_paper {background: url(../images/container_paper_bg_001.jpg); width: 900px; position: relative; left: 50px;text-align: left; padding-bottom: 32px;}
#logout { position: absolute; top: 45px; left: 650px; z-index: 5; }

#main_menu {background: url(../images/menu_bodak_001.gif); width: 862px; height: 677px; position: relative; left: 32px;}
#main_menu .logo {background: url(../images/bodak_k98k_logo.gif); width: 310px; height: 47px; display: block; margin-top: 32px;}
#main_menu ul {margin: 36px 0px 0px 16px;}
#main_menu li {float: left; margin-right: 40px; line-height: 15px; height: 15px; list-style-type: none; overflow: hidden;}
#main_menu .b_1 {background: url(../images/main_menu_uvod_001.gif) 0px 15px; width: 43px; height: 15px;  display: block;}
#main_menu .b_1:hover {background: url(../images/main_menu_uvod_001.gif);}
#main_menu .b_1_active {background: url(../images/main_menu_uvod_001.gif); width: 43px; height: 15px; display: block;}
#main_menu .b_2 {background: url(../images/main_menu_o_me_001.gif) 0px 15px; width: 48px; height: 15px; display: block;}
#main_menu .b_2:hover {background: url(../images/main_menu_o_me_001.gif);}
#main_menu .b_2_active {background: url(../images/main_menu_o_me_001.gif); width: 48px; height: 15px; display: block;}
#main_menu .b_3 {background: url(../images/main_menu_historie_001.gif) 0px 15px; width: 83px; height: 15px; display: block;}
#main_menu .b_3:hover {background: url(../images/main_menu_historie_001.gif);}
#main_menu .b_3_active {background: url(../images/main_menu_historie_001.gif); width: 83px; height: 15px; display: block;}
#main_menu .b_4 {background: url(../images/main_menu_fotogalerie_001.gif) 0px 15px; width: 112px; height: 15px; display: block;}
#main_menu .b_4:hover {background: url(../images/main_menu_fotogalerie_001.gif);}
#main_menu .b_4_active {background: url(../images/main_menu_fotogalerie_001.gif); width: 112px; height: 15px; display: block;}
#main_menu .b_5 {background: url(../images/main_menu_forum_001.gif) 0px 15px; width: 145px; height: 15px; display: block;}
#main_menu .b_5:hover {background: url(../images/main_menu_forum_001.gif);}
#main_menu .b_5_active {background: url(../images/main_menu_forum_001.gif); width: 145px; height: 15px; display: block;}
#main_menu .b_6 {background: url(../images/main_menu_kontakt_001.gif) 0px 15px; width: 74px; height: 15px; display: block;}
#main_menu .b_6:hover {background: url(../images/main_menu_kontakt_001.gif);}
#main_menu .b_6_active {background: url(../images/main_kontakt_uvod_001.gif); width: 74px; height: 15px; display: block;}

#left_block {width: 200px; display: block; position: relative; left: 32px; margin-top: -500px; min-height: 501px; display: block; overflow: hidden;}
#left_block .left_menu {background: url(../images/left_menu_middle_001.jpg); width: 200px; display: block; margin-bottom: 32px;}
#left_block .left_menu ul {width: 152px; display: block; position: relative; left: 24px;}
#left_block .left_menu li {float: left; list-style-type: none; margin: 0px 0px 8px 0px; width: 100%;}
#left_block .left_menu a {color: #210; text-decoration: none; font-family: courier new;}
#left_block .left_menu a:hover {color: #800b06;}
#left_block .left_menu .hr {background: url(../images/hr_001.gif); width: 150px; height: 1px; display: block; overflow: hidden;}
#left_block .left_menu .top {background: url(../images/left_menu_top_001.jpg); width: 200px; height: 10px; display: block; margin-bottom: 8px; overflow: hidden;}
#left_block .left_menu .bottom {background: url(../images/left_menu_bottom_001.jpg); width: 200px; height: 10px; display: block; margin-top: 8px; overflow: hidden;}

#content {width: 500px; margin-top: -500px; position: relative; left: 64px;}

#content img { margin: 10px; float: none;}

#content .gal 			 { margin-bottom: 16px;}
#content .gal .thumb 	 { background: url(../images/thumb_001.jpg); width: 160px; height: 196px; margin: 0px 6px 16px 0px; float: left;}
#content .gal .thumb p	 { margin-left: 8px; text-decoration: none;}
#content .gal .thumb img { min-width: 153px; margin:0;	}
#content .gal .thumbImg  { width: 153px; height: 87px; overflow: hidden; padding: 2px 0px 12px 4px; margin-bottom: 5px;}
#content .fotka			 { width: 100%;}

.butonek	{ padding-left: 10px; }

#contact-form { clear: both; }
form
fieldset 				{ margin: 10px 15px 10px 0px; border: 1px solid #cd853f; padding: 10px; }
legend 					{ color: #750b05; font-weight: bolder; padding: 0px 10px 0px 10px; }
.form_cell_1 			{ width: 140px; vertical-align: top; display: inline-table; text-align: right; margin-top: 7px; color: #333333; }
.submit_form 			{ float: right; border: 1px solid #750b05; background-color: #cd853f; color: #750b05; padding: 3px 15px 3px 15px; float: right; margin-right: 15px;}
.submit_form:hover		{ background-color: #DD954F; cursor: pointer; }


#footer {background: url(../images/footer_bg_001.jpg); width: 836px; height: 41px; display: block; position: relative; left: 32px; margin-top: 16px;}
#footer p {margin: 0px; line-height: 40px; width: 804px; position: relative; left: 16px;}
#footer span {float: right;}
#footer ul {position: relative; top: 40px; right: 32px; float: right;}
#footer li {color: #777; line-height: 40px; list-style-type: none; font-size: 11px; font-weight: 900; margin-right: 8px; float: left;}

